Longclaw safari
This fantastic 9 night fly-in safari takes in Tarangire National Park, as well as two different areas of the Serengeti, the far north and the south; you can therefore experience the the gentle rolling country of the quiet and wild north and short grass plains of the south. Depart London Heathrow on a scheduled British Airways overnight flight, for Arusha Airport via Dar es Salaam. |
Arrive at Arusha airport mid-morning, where a superior guide will meet and drive you through Arusha and into the country-side. Enjoy charming scenery on your way to Tarangire's park gate, then once inside start watching out for some of the park's varied wildlife before arriving at… |
| Oliver's Camp (full board & activities) |
| Whilst based at this friendly and well-run camp, explore the surrounding area either on foot or in a open 4x4 vehicle using the camp's own excellent guides. You will find good game here especially during the dry season when animals are attracted to the nearby marshes. |
In the morning after breakfast, catch a light aircraft into the southern Serengeti where your private driver will meet you. Meander back to camp, stopping to see any interesting game you pass on your way. Then arrive in time for a lovely lunch at the luxury semi-permanent …. |
| Suyan Camp (full board & activities) |
| This smart mobile camp moves around the Southern Plains of the Serengeti National Park which harbour good game – and you'll explore the area using your own private open 4x4 vehicle and superior guide. |
After exploring the south, hop on to another flight which will take you up to the seriously remote northern Serengeti. An open 4x4 and camp guide will meet you upon arrival and take you on a game drive whilst en-route to the luxurious bushcamp… |
| Sayari Camp (full board & activities) |
| Sayari is the only permanent camp this far north in the Serengeti National Park and is a wonderful place to spend 3 nights. The resident game around here is very good in this magnificent wilderness area. However, around August to November the great migration is likely to also be here, so it's an ideal base for seeking out spectacular crossings of the Mara River. |

After your last morning on safari, fly to Kilimanjaro Airport and then either continue onto one of our beach holiday add-ons, or connect with your evening British Airways flight to London via Nairobi. |
|
Arrive at London Heathrow early in the morning, with plenty of time to make onward connections home. |
